Class MetricsNaming

java.lang.Object
io.vertx.micrometer.MetricsNaming

public class MetricsNaming extends Object
Options for naming all metrics
Author:
Joel Takvorian
  • Constructor Details

    • MetricsNaming

      public MetricsNaming()
      Default constructor
    • MetricsNaming

      public MetricsNaming(MetricsNaming other)
      Copy constructor
      Parameters:
      other - The other MetricsNaming to copy when creating this
    • MetricsNaming

      public MetricsNaming(JsonObject json)
      Create an instance from a JsonObject
      Parameters:
      json - the JsonObject to create it from
  • Method Details

    • toJson

      public JsonObject toJson()
      Returns:
      a JSON representation of these options
    • v3Names

      @Deprecated(forRemoval=true) public static MetricsNaming v3Names()
      Deprecated, for removal: This API element is subject to removal in a future version.
      as of 5.1
    • v4Names

      public static MetricsNaming v4Names()
    • getClientQueueTime

      public String getClientQueueTime()
    • getClientQueuePending

      public String getClientQueuePending()
    • getClientProcessingTime

      public String getClientProcessingTime()
    • getClientProcessingPending

      public String getClientProcessingPending()
    • getClientResetsCount

      public String getClientResetsCount()
    • getDatagramBytesRead

      public String getDatagramBytesRead()
    • getDatagramBytesWritten

      public String getDatagramBytesWritten()
    • getDatagramErrorCount

      public String getDatagramErrorCount()
    • getEbHandlers

      public String getEbHandlers()
    • getEbPending

      public String getEbPending()
    • getEbProcessed

      public String getEbProcessed()
    • getEbPublished

      public String getEbPublished()
    • getEbSent

      public String getEbSent()
    • getEbReceived

      public String getEbReceived()
    • getEbDelivered

      public String getEbDelivered()
    • getEbDiscarded

      public String getEbDiscarded()
    • getEbReplyFailures

      public String getEbReplyFailures()
    • getEbBytesRead

      public String getEbBytesRead()
    • getEbBytesWritten

      public String getEbBytesWritten()
    • getHttpQueueTime

      public String getHttpQueueTime()
    • getHttpQueuePending

      public String getHttpQueuePending()
    • getHttpActiveRequests

      public String getHttpActiveRequests()
    • getHttpRequestsCount

      public String getHttpRequestsCount()
    • getHttpRequestBytes

      public String getHttpRequestBytes()
    • getHttpResponseTime

      public String getHttpResponseTime()
    • getHttpResponsesCount

      public String getHttpResponsesCount()
    • getHttpResponseBytes

      public String getHttpResponseBytes()
    • getHttpActiveWsConnections

      public String getHttpActiveWsConnections()
    • getHttpRequestResetsCount

      public String getHttpRequestResetsCount()
    • getNetActiveConnections

      public String getNetActiveConnections()
    • getPoolUsage

      public String getPoolUsage()
    • getPoolInUse

      public String getPoolInUse()
    • getPoolUsageRatio

      public String getPoolUsageRatio()
    • getPoolCompleted

      public String getPoolCompleted()
    • setClientQueueTime

      public MetricsNaming setClientQueueTime(String clientQueueTime)
    • setClientQueuePending

      public MetricsNaming setClientQueuePending(String clientQueuePending)
    • setClientProcessingTime

      public MetricsNaming setClientProcessingTime(String clientProcessingTime)
    • setClientProcessingPending

      public MetricsNaming setClientProcessingPending(String clientProcessingPending)
    • setClientResetsCount

      public MetricsNaming setClientResetsCount(String clientResetsCount)
    • setDatagramBytesRead

      public MetricsNaming setDatagramBytesRead(String datagramBytesRead)
    • setDatagramBytesWritten

      public MetricsNaming setDatagramBytesWritten(String datagramBytesWritten)
    • setDatagramErrorCount

      public MetricsNaming setDatagramErrorCount(String datagramErrorCount)
    • setEbHandlers

      public MetricsNaming setEbHandlers(String ebHandlers)
    • setEbPending

      public MetricsNaming setEbPending(String ebPending)
    • setEbProcessed

      public MetricsNaming setEbProcessed(String ebProcessed)
    • setEbPublished

      public MetricsNaming setEbPublished(String ebPublished)
    • setEbSent

      public MetricsNaming setEbSent(String ebSent)
    • setEbReceived

      public MetricsNaming setEbReceived(String ebReceived)
    • setEbDelivered

      public MetricsNaming setEbDelivered(String ebDelivered)
    • setEbDiscarded

      public MetricsNaming setEbDiscarded(String ebDiscarded)
    • setEbReplyFailures

      public MetricsNaming setEbReplyFailures(String ebReplyFailures)
    • setEbBytesRead

      public MetricsNaming setEbBytesRead(String ebBytesRead)
    • setEbBytesWritten

      public MetricsNaming setEbBytesWritten(String ebBytesWritten)
    • setHttpQueueTime

      public MetricsNaming setHttpQueueTime(String httpQueueTime)
    • setHttpQueuePending

      public MetricsNaming setHttpQueuePending(String httpQueuePending)
    • setHttpActiveRequests

      public MetricsNaming setHttpActiveRequests(String httpActiveRequests)
    • setHttpRequestsCount

      public MetricsNaming setHttpRequestsCount(String httpRequestsCount)
    • setHttpRequestBytes

      public MetricsNaming setHttpRequestBytes(String httpRequestBytes)
    • setHttpResponseTime

      public MetricsNaming setHttpResponseTime(String httpResponseTime)
    • setHttpResponsesCount

      public MetricsNaming setHttpResponsesCount(String httpResponsesCount)
    • setHttpResponseBytes

      public MetricsNaming setHttpResponseBytes(String httpResponseBytes)
    • setHttpActiveWsConnections

      public MetricsNaming setHttpActiveWsConnections(String httpActiveWsConnections)
    • setHttpRequestResetsCount

      public MetricsNaming setHttpRequestResetsCount(String httpRequestResetsCount)
    • setNetActiveConnections

      public MetricsNaming setNetActiveConnections(String netActiveConnections)
    • setPoolUsage

      public MetricsNaming setPoolUsage(String poolUsage)
    • setPoolInUse

      public MetricsNaming setPoolInUse(String poolInUse)
    • setPoolUsageRatio

      public MetricsNaming setPoolUsageRatio(String poolUsageRatio)
    • setPoolCompleted

      public MetricsNaming setPoolCompleted(String poolCompleted)
    • getNetBytesRead

      public String getNetBytesRead()
    • setNetBytesRead

      public MetricsNaming setNetBytesRead(String netBytesRead)
    • getNetBytesWritten

      public String getNetBytesWritten()
    • setNetBytesWritten

      public MetricsNaming setNetBytesWritten(String netBytesWritten)
    • getNetErrorCount

      public String getNetErrorCount()
    • setNetErrorCount

      public MetricsNaming setNetErrorCount(String netErrorCount)
    • getPoolQueueTime

      public String getPoolQueueTime()
    • setPoolQueueTime

      public MetricsNaming setPoolQueueTime(String poolQueueTime)
    • getPoolQueuePending

      public String getPoolQueuePending()
    • setPoolQueuePending

      public MetricsNaming setPoolQueuePending(String poolQueuePending)
    • withBaseName

      public MetricsNaming withBaseName(String baseName)